Web2.3.4 Scatter plots. A scatter plot is a simple visualization of the relationship between two numerical vari- ables and is one of the most popular plotting tools in existence. In a scatter plot, the value of the feature is plotted versus the value of the response variable, with each instance represented as a dot. Web3 de out. de 2024 · This scatter plot from The Atlantic Cities (2012) plots a city's "Metro Health Index" (a factor measuring the share of people who smoke or are obese) as it correlates to the city's median income. Note that the plot does not prove causation between income and health in this instance—just that the two are related.
